Deep beneath the waves, where light gives way to silence and mystery, one figure continues to redefine the limits of human exploration: James Cameron. Known globally as a filmmaker, his deeper legacy lies in the groundbreaking deep-sea missions that have reshaped our understanding of Earth’s hidden oceans. With “James Cameron: The Visionary Behind the World’s Most Shocking Deep-Sea Discoveries,” audiences now turn to his pioneering work not just as entertainment, but as a vital window into the planet’s final frontiers.
He operates at the intersection of storytelling and science,Cameron’s role in deep-sea exploration extends beyond cinematic ambition. He is a hands-on technologist and visionary who designs submersibles and leads expeditions that push engineering boundaries. These missions are built on advanced robotics, pressure-resistant materials, and real-time data capture—tools now accessible to scientists worldwide. What sets Cameron apart is his consistent focus on using exploration as a catalyst for scientific understanding, not spectacle.
